摘要
随着Internet的爆炸式增长,现有的路由算法RIP和OSPF已难以满足用户的多QoS要求。在分析经典分布式路由算法的基础上,提出了一种面向Agent的分布式路由算法。该算法的路径选择策略不是采用“源节点控制算法”,而是依据路由中所得到的时延实测值,由各节点独立地选择下一个节点(最佳节点)。仿真表明该算法是有效的。
Along with the explosive development of Internet,existing routing algorithm,such as RIP and OSPF,can't be satisfied with the multi-QoS demand.Based on analyzing the classic distributed routing algorithm,a new agent-oriented distributed routing algorithm is discussed in this paper.The new strategy is that the next node(optimal node)is choice by the former node with the real-time data in routing delay,which is different from the original node-control algorithm.The results of simulations show that the algorithm is effective.
